yeh i got the same when i was first training frontsplits, you say you are really close to getting it with your left leg in front? and its the top of your left hamstring that hurts, so i bet u are pushing the stretch a bit further on that side in eagerness to get the full split. Just make sure yout legs are fully warmed up (maybe go for a jog and do some front leg lifts and hamstring stretches first) before training the splits, also dont rush into forcing yourself down as far as you can go, ease slowly into it and dont push the stretch too far too early. no, its just overstretching. Ballistic stretching is when you bounce to push the stretch further which can cause injury. As for resting, just do what feels right i tend to stretch every other day. If my hamstrings are feeling particularly tight on my 'rest' day il do some light dynamic stretching to loosen them up a bit.
